Luis Meléndez (1716–1780), also recorded as Luis Egidio, Luis Eugenio, or Luis Eugidio Meléndez, was a Spanish painter identified especially with eighteenth-century still-life painting. Public descriptions emphasize his close observation of ordinary food and kitchen objects and his handling of composition, light, volume, and surface texture. These qualities made everyday provisions the central subjects of carefully organized paintings rather than incidental decorative details. Collectors may encounter his work under more than one given-name variant, making identity normalization important when consulting collection catalogues, bibliographic records, and auction listings. Authority records maintained by Wikidata, Getty ULAN, VIAF, and IdRef connect these variants with the painter who lived from 1716 to 1780. Public descriptions identify Meléndez principally with paintings, especially still lifes centered on food and ordinary kitchen fare. Works catalogued merely as attributed to, after, or in the manner of an artist should not be treated as equivalent to firmly attributed works.
